GameFire.sys is a system driver used to enhance the performance of gaming on Windows-based computers. It works by optimizing system resources and prioritizing them for gaming, resulting in smoother gameplay and reduced lag. This driver is designed to work in the background without requiring any user intervention, making it a convenient tool for gamers looking to improve their gaming experience.

Understanding Common Issues with Sys Files

Sys files, such as GameFire.sys, are integral to your computer's functioning, but they can sometimes run into problems. These issues might arise due to file corruption, accidental deletion, or conflicts with new software. When such problems occur, they can cause system instability, including slowdowns, crashes, or even the dreaded Blue Screen of Death (BSOD).

  • Blue Screen of Death (BSOD): The computer's screen turning blue and showing an error code is a classic sign of .sys file problems.
  • Functionality Issues: If some applications or hardware don't work properly, it could be because a .sys file related to them has been corrupted.
  • Reduced Performance: The computer may become notably slow, a common symptom of a corrupted .sys file.
  • Frequent System Crashes: If your computer frequently crashes or restarts without warning, it may be due to a corrupted .sys file.
  • Error Messages: Upon booting the computer, running specific software, or installing a new program, you may encounter error messages tied to a .sys file.
